Whariki Trust is a Trust charity in the Health sector, based in Wellington, Wellington. Financial data as at March 2025.
Mission: Our Vision for Whariki Trust is an organisation that: Is passionate about our rangatahi and really does make a positive and substantial contribution to rangatahi development; Fully understands abreast of the needs of our whānau and provides a range of quality programmes that match those needs; Is genuinely committed to maintaining a strong values and tikanga base in all that it does; Attracts and retains skilled staff and trustees who are: o Absolutely passionate and committed to the kaupapa o In touch with issues affecting our rangatahi & whānau; o Reliable and trustworthy; Is recognised as an organisation that is innovative and gets real results; Enjoys strong networks and support locally, nationally and globally; Is financially secure and not dependent on Government contracts alone.
